What skills and experience we're looking for

We have an exciting and rare opportunity to welcome a new member to our family as we prepare to open our brand-new Enhanced Resource Base (ERB) for pupils with autism in September 2026. This is a chance to help shape, grow and lead a brand-new provision at its very beginning, and we hope that person might be you!

  • Places children at the centre of every decision and builds warm, nurturing and trusting relationships.
  • Is a skilled, reflective practitioner with experience of supporting pupils with autism.
  • Can lead the day‑to‑day provision for up to 10 pupils within the new ERB, ensuring high expectations.
  • Can act as the school’s autism specialist, promoting best practice and guiding colleagues.
  • Brings creativity, enthusiasm and a commitment to shaping a quality brand‑new provision.
  • Works collaboratively and with a positive, team‑focused approach and can manage a small team of Teaching Assistants.
  • Works closely with families, external professionals and mainstream class teachers to support pupil progress, smooth transitions and meaningful inclusion.
  • Can oversee and complete statutory paperwork, including EHCP reviews, ensuring high‑quality, timely and accurate documentation.

What the school offers its staff

  • A friendly, supportive and committed staff team.
  • A strong emphasis on professional development, including specialist SEND training.
  • Fun, hard‑working and enthusiastic children.
  • The unique and rewarding opportunity to help establish a brand‑new Enhanced Resource Base.
  • An excellent ‘Teachers’ Pension’.
  • Free eye tests.
  • Free flu jabs.
  • A genuine commitment to staff wellbeing, including PPA time that can be taken at home, a “Golden Ticket Day” – one day each year to use entirely as you wish, and sociable staff events.
